The GetRetryCount returns the retry count for the current
client session.
Return Value
If the method succeeds, the return value is the retry count. If
the method fails, the return value is DNS_ERROR. To get extended
error information, call GetLastError.
Remarks
The retry count determines the amount of time the client will wait
for a response from each query, the effective amount of time the
client will wait increases with each nameserver and the total number
of retries specified. For example, two nameservers registered with
the client, with a default of 4 retries per nameserver and a timeout
value of 10 seconds, would cause the client to wait a total of 80
seconds until it returns an error indicating that it was unable to
resolve the query.
